About Castle Hill 2154

The size of Castle Hill is approximately 18.9 square kilometres. It has 68 parks covering nearly 12.1% of total area. The population of Castle Hill in 2011 was 37,916 people. By 2016 the population was 39,624 showing a population growth of 4.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Castle Hill is 40-49 years. Households in Castle Hill are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Castle Hill work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 79% of the homes in Castle Hill were owner-occupied compared with 74.5% in 2016.

Castle Hill has 18,248 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Castle Hill have seen a 73.79%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 20.23%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Castle Hill is $2,377,975 while the median value for Units is $973,943.
  • Houses have a median rent of $880 while Units have a median rent of $720.
There are currently 137 properties listed for sale, and 55 properties listed for rent in Castle hill on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 980 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Castle hill.
